Colorpuncture is a non-invasive technique, derived from chromo-therapy, which uses Acupuncture points in a therapeutic way, aiming at the body’s energy balance. Created in Germany by Peter Mandel, it combines knowledge of Traditional Chinese Medicine and other fields of Western knowledge. The applications are of micro beams of colored light, where there are the colors called hot and cold, corresponding respectively to the toning and sedative effect, replacing the use of acupuncture needles.
